Piramal Finance Ltd
Press Release dated 16th July 2026, titled "Piramal Finance reports PAT of Rs. 461 crore in Q1 FY2027, up 67% YoY"

In Simple Terms
Piramal Finance's first-quarter profit jumped significantly, its loan book grew, and its board approved raising up to ₹ 4,000 Cr.
🤖 AI Summary
  • Piramal Finance reported Profit After Tax (PAT) of ₹ 461 Cr in Q1 FY27, representing a 67% Year-on-Year increase.
  • Assets Under Management (AUM) increased 25% YoY to ₹ 1,06,940 Cr, with Retail AUM growing 32% YoY to ₹ 91,249 Cr.
  • Retail disbursements for the quarter rose 44% YoY to ₹ 12,527 Cr, supporting the overall AUM growth.
  • The Board approved a fundraise of up to ₹ 4,000 Cr, to be raised post shareholder approval at an appropriate time.
  • The company's nationwide footprint expanded to 780 branches, and its customer base grew 24% YoY to 6 million.

🏢 How This Affects the Company
📈
Business Impact
The growth in AUM, particularly retail AUM, and increased disbursements indicate an expanding business scale and market penetration. The expansion to 780 branches and 6 million customers strengthens its distribution and customer franchise.
💰
Financial Impact
Profit After Tax increased by 67% YoY to ₹ 461 Cr, alongside Net Income Margin expansion by 47 bps YoY to 6.5%. The approved fundraise of up to ₹ 4,000 Cr, upon execution, will enhance the company's capital base and liquidity.
⚙️
Operational Impact
Expansion to 780 branches and 607 cities reflects ongoing operational scale-up. AI adoption across underwriting, collections, and customer service is driving efficiency, with AI-driven monthly collections increasing nearly 12x to ₹ 1,019 Cr.
⚠️
Risk Impact
Asset quality remained stable with GNPA at 2.4% and NNPA at 1.6%. The deployment of AI agents flagged over 18 lakh fraud cases in Q1 FY27, enhancing fraud detection and potentially mitigating credit risk.

⚖️ Strengths & Concerns

✅ Positives

  • Profit After Tax (PAT) grew 67% YoY to ₹ 461 Cr in Q1 FY27, indicating strong profitability expansion.
  • Assets Under Management (AUM) increased 25% YoY to ₹ 1,06,940 Cr, driven by 32% YoY growth in Retail AUM to ₹ 91,249 Cr.

⚠️ Concerns

  • Loan loss provisions and FV loss / (gain) increased by 127% YoY to ₹ 460 Cr in Q1 FY27.
  • Profit after tax declined 8% QoQ from ₹ 502 Cr in Q4 FY26 to ₹ 461 Cr in Q1 FY27.
